An implant is a more complicated surgical procedure that entails your prior visit to the dental clinic for consultation. You will have to meet with your dentist first in order for your condition to be checked and for you to be assessed as a possible candidate for an implant dental surgery. Not all patients can have one due to several reasons. There are patients who do not have enough for the implant to be placed thus for them they would still need a bone graft before they can have one. You do not have to undergo the same procedure unless your condition will be like theirs. Your CT scan will reveal if you will be required to have a bone graft or not.

If you are a smoker, there might be a tendency that even a top dental implant dentistNJ will not perform an implant for you. Smoking might have an adverse effect on the procedure since patients who smoke may encounter problems in healing and the implant may not fuse with the bone. That would be a risky condition that any implant dentist New Jersey would like to avoid. There might be other problems which may arise like a dental implant infection due to poor dental hygiene.
